Specifications for the LQM21NN3R3K10L
Part Name | LQM21NN3R3K10L |
Manufacturer | Murata |
Category | Surface Mount Inductors |

Maximum Dc Resistance | 800 (mΩ) |
Inductor Construction | Multilayer |
Minimum Quality Factor | 45 |
Maximum Dc Current (A) | 30 (mA) |
Series | LQM21N |
Depth | 1.25 (mm) |
Height | 0.5 (mm) |
Length | 2 (mm) |
Inductance | 3.3 μH |
Maximum Self Resonant Frequency | 59 (MHz) |
Maximum Operating Temperature | +85 (°C) |
Tolerance | ±10 (%) |
Minimum Operating Temperature | -40 (°C) |
Package/Case | 0805 (2012M) |
